The Gwydir Community Business and Education Awards acknowledge outstanding businesses and their people who go above and beyond, providing an exceptional customer service experience. During the past 22 years, these awards have become a powerful symbol that local businesses aspire to. All members of the Gwydir Shire community are encouraged to recognise the efforts of our local businesses by voting in this year’s awards.

The Awards are broken up into the following categories:

  • Senior Employee/ Proprietor 30yrs and over,
  • Junior Employee under 30yrs,
  • Small Business (5 employees or less) and
  • Large Business (5 or more).

A fifth category, the ‘Enterprise with Energy’ Award, has been added this year as a result of ‘The Idea Factory – Enterprise with Energy’ initiative between Warialda High School and Gwydir Shire Council. This initiative aims to encourage Warialda High school students, as well as others with great business ideas, to jump in and start their own small business. The initiative will see budding entrepreneurs submit their business idea to a panel of judges.

Along the way, these applicants will be provided with advice and support to fully develop their concept, and to ensure their ideas become a viable and sustainable business. Information such as budgeting, business planning, marketing and tips to navigate red tape will be provided through access to expert business advisors.

To further assist, each applicant will be assigned a business mentor. These mentors are local businessmen and women with extensive experience in their chosen field who will advise and guide the start-up on a range of business matters.

An added incentive of $500 for the best high school business ideas, and $1,000 for the best community business idea will be awarded with the best business ideas announced at this year’s Business Awards.
